I have just fitted a Western Digital 500Gb SATA hard drive to my computer.
Windows reported 'new hardware found', 'driver installed' & 'device working'.
When I looked in 'my computer' it showed my partitioned HDD, drives C & D but not my new one.
Device manager shows the drive and in the volumes tab says 'not initialized'.
I can't seem to get access to it to do anything - anybody any ideas?

You will need to create a partition and activate the drive.

Go to Control panel/system &security/admin tools/ create and format hardrives (Disk Management)

You will see a disk (Disc 2 or 3 or something like that ) that is not mounted/recognised.. You will need to mark the partition as active and format it, give it a drive letter and away you go.
